Composer Eric Nathan to Release New Album, SOME FAVORED NOOK, Libretto by Mark Campbell by BWW News Desk
- July 26, 2023 Composer Eric Nathan releases Some Favored Nook, a new album featuring a song cycle that sets the writings of Emily Dickinson to music. The album, with a libretto by Mark Campbell, explores themes of love, war, and women's rights.

S. Carey & John Raymond Release 'Steadfast' Featuring Gordi by Michael Major
- July 26, 2023 GRAMMY-nominated trumpeter John Raymond and Bon Iver sideman S. Carey released “Steadfast” featuring Australian singer-songwriter Gordi — it’s the newest single from Raymond and Carey’s upcoming collaborative album Shadowlands. The album was produced by Sun Chung, and will be released on the Libellule Editions imprint of Chung’s Red Hook Records.

Sara Noelle Shares a Cover of The Beta Band's 'Dry The Rain' by Michael Major
- July 26, 2023 Noelle's last album was released in Jan. of this year. The song had it's world premiere on KCRW with DJ Travis Holcombe. Sara Noelle is a singer-songwriter who creates indie-folk and ambient-inspired music. Her third full-length album, Do I Have to Feel Everything, produced by Dan Duszynski, was released in January.
